Program on climate change put into reality

VGP – PM Nguyen Tan Dung on Wednesday presided over the 4th meeting of the National Committee on Climate Change to review the work in 2013 and define key missions in 2014.

PM Dung asked ministries, agencies and localities to promptly promulgate and implement Resolution No. 24/NQ-TW of the Party Central Committee on actively coping with climate change, increasing natural resources management and protecting the environment.

“Mechanisms on climate change response should be updated, supplemented and finalized”, said PM Dung.

The host leader also requested his inferiors to improve disaster forecasts; compose scenarios on climate change impacts; prioritize financial sources; mobilize social resources; build anti-flood projects in urban areas; and ensure the safety of reservoirs.

PM Dung emphasized that besides spending the State budget ministries and agencies should pay attention to mobilizing social resources and strengthening international cooperation to learn experience from other countries on response to climate change, sea level rises and environmental protection.  

In 2014, the National Committee on Climate Change would focus on key tasks including reviewing, updating and adjusting strategies and plans of ministries and agencies in accordance with Resolution No. 24/NQ-TW.

In addition, mechanisms and polices on green growth and climate change response would be realized. The goals of green growth and climate change response would be incorporated with socio-economic development plans at local and ministerial levels./.
